Responsibilities: The purpose of the Project Manager position is to oversee projects and track activity in order to initiate corrective actions to keep the project on scheduled even when the inevitable or unexpected occurs. This helps maintain realistic goals, update the plans and stay on track. Project control, or tracking, is a feedback loop in which we compare actual results against a plan; assess the impact of any deviations from target dates and costs; and determine corrective actions. Proper control cannot be exerted without this feedback loop.
